We have all been called for a purpose and God has given us gifts and talents to fulfill that purpose. We are all individual and unique and that is why we need to embrace who we are and not try to be something we are not.
You are the right man/woman for the job! Many times we look at things through the eyes of our own limitations instead of looking through the eyes of God’s unlimited possibilities. We hold ourselves back through fear instead of operating in faith. However faith is the thing that causes God’s hand to move and fear holds it back: Heb 11:6 Now without faith it is impossible to please God, for whoever comes to him must believe that he exists and that he rewards those who diligently search for him. If God chose you before the foundations of the world to good works, why do you doubt his ability to fulfill it in you? A good example of a person who started off in fear but ended up in faith is Gideon, he really doubted the fact that God could use him because he thought he was insignificant. He was looking through the eyes of fear instead of through the eyes of God’s unlimited possibilities: Jdg 6:11 Gideon is Visited by the Angel of the LORD After this, the angel of the LORD arrived and sat down in the shade of the oak tree in Ophrah that belonged to Joash, a descendant of Abiezer, while his son Gideon was threshing wheat in a wine press in order to safeguard it from the Midianites. Jdg 6:12 The angel of the LORD appeared to him and told him, “The LORD is with you, you valiant warrior!” Jdg 6:13 But Gideon replied, “Right… Sir, if the LORD is with us, then why has all of this happened to us? And where are all of his miraculous works that our ancestors recounted to us when they said, ‘The LORD brought us up from Egypt, didn’t he?’ But now the LORD has abandoned us and given us over to Midian!” Jdg 6:14 The LORD looked straight at him and replied, “Go with this determination of yours and deliver Israel from Midian’s domination. I’ve directed you, haven’t I?” Jdg 6:15 “Right…,” Gideon responded. “Sir, how will I deliver Israel? Look—my family is the weakest in Manasseh, and I’m the youngest in my father’s household.” He was the right man for the job even if he did not know it yet and God’s grace was such that he allowed him to go through the process of beginning in fear and ending up in faith. Even when God proved himself to him, Gideon still doubted, but God still allowed him to go through the process: Jdg 6:36 Gideon Asks for a Sign from God Then Gideon told God, “If you intend to deliver Israel by my efforts as you’ve said, Jdg 6:37 then take a look at this wool fleece that I’m placing on the threshing floor. If dew appears only on the fleece—and it’s dry on the ground all around it—then I’ll know that you’ll deliver Israel by my efforts like you’ve said.” Jdg 6:38 And that is what happened: When he got up early the next morning, he wrung out the fleece to drain the dew from it and extracted a bowl full of water. Jdg 6:39 Then Gideon told God, “Don’t let yourself be angry with me! I want to ask you once again: please let me make a test with the fleece just once more. Cause it to be dry only on the fleece, but let there be dew all around on the ground.” Jdg 6:40 And God did it just like that later that night. It was dry only on the fleece, but dew was all around on the ground. Eventually Gibeon was able to defeat an army of thousands with only 300 hundred men. God knows the end from the beginning, so he know where you are in your faith right now, but he also knows where your are going to be and he give you grace for your individual journey.
